Output 6422a2506a95cfc976c781ea99394bc91bf1806a64756b4e3c737bf2c2847749:1

value
915623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88442cfcc1da2745e2ace06d8c2573a1f175f894 OP_EQUAL
address
3E7XVZkrkpDNwFbvan7TDSq1H5FSTyrhE8
transaction
6422a2506a95cfc976c781ea99394bc91bf1806a64756b4e3c737bf2c2847749
spent
true